A Bend based company is gearing up to show off its technology at the Oregon Entrepreneurs Network Venture conference in Portland next month. Proxense is one of ten companies chosen to pitch their inventions at this conference. Founder John Giobbi began work on his product five years ago. He'll be showing off this pocket-sized wireless transmitter. Since December the Bend Memorial Clinic has been testing it out. It's designed to help cut down the amount of time doctors spend logging on and off their computers. "With our technology as they approach a work station they're automatically authenticated so we know for sure it's really who we think they are and then they're software launches and it logs them in automatically," said Giobbi.
In the future Giobbi hopes to expand to patients, allowing you to have all your medical records on one little chip making it easier when you go to a new doctor.
